In the Community Violence Intervention (CVI) field, the physical and emotional demands of leadership can take a toll on health of emergency first responders, violence interrupters, and community mediators from around the country of United States. I have partnered with Advance Peace, a national organization dedicated to ending cyclical and retaliatory gun violence in American urban neighborhoods.

I hold webinars that are scheduled every 3 months and Myo Office hours twice a month for credible messengers who are working to build healthier, safer and more just communities by transforming the lives of individuals at the center of gun violence, HEALING COMMUNITIES.

The goals are to improve leadership with focus, composure, and resilience to manage stress more effectively in high-pressure environments by improving sleep health: Make sleep health a priority for healing and recovery

Throughout the series, participants will discover 4 macronutrients of sleep: quality, quantity, regularity and timing, sleep hygiene and proper breathing.
